Residential burglary suspect is quickly arrested by Atlanta officers
On October 11, 2022, Atlanta police were dispatched to W. Roxboro Rd in reference to a residential burglary. Upon arrival, the officer met with the reporting party who advised the property belonged to a former Atlanta Falcons football player.
Further investigation revealed there was clothing and jewelry that was stolen from the residence by the suspect. Through means of technology, officers were able to observe the male suspect and broadcast over radio his physical description. An officer working an off-duty extra job on patrol observed a male matching the description and was able to detain him without incident.
Further investigation revealed the suspect was in possession of stolen property from the residence and was wearing some of the stolen clothing. The male was later identified as 31-year-old Mr. Martin Williams and he was charged with two counts of 1st Degree Burglary.
